Material Finishes: key points

Benefits breakdown: finishes and material options

SATTLER Lighting on aluminium luminaires

SATTLER Lighting states that most SATTLER luminaires are manufactured from high-quality aluminium, which is often selected in projects for robust fabrication and controlled detailing.

SATTLER Lighting on premium surface finishes

SATTLER Lighting offers various surface finishes including powder coating, hand-polishing, and brushed aluminium, which supports consistent visual language across a project.

SATTLER Lighting on anodised colour options

SATTLER Lighting states that anodised finishes are available in elegant silver, bronze, black, and champagne gold, which can be used to align luminaires with metalwork and interior palettes.

SATTLER Lighting on natural material finishes

SATTLER Lighting states that natural material finishes for luminaires include leather and real wood veneers, which is often used where warmer, tactile surfaces are part of the concept.

SATTLER Lighting on wood veneer variants

SATTLER Lighting states that wood veneer options for premium surfaces include Elm, Oak, Cherrywood, Eucalyptus, and Walnut, enabling a defined selection of timber appearances.

How material performance is handled in development

  1. SATTLER Lighting states that materials are fine-tuned during the development process to meet technical requirements such as thermal conductivity and optical properties.
